Location
Loews Hôtel Vogue is located in the heart of downtown Montreal on de la Montagne Street and is at the epicentre of Montreal’s Golden Square Mile. Loews Hotel Vogue is surrounded by the best Montreal has to offer: museums, galleries, international shopping and non-stop nightlife.

Airport
Pierre-Elliot Trudeau International Airport is located 18 kilometers (11 miles) from the hotel, or approximately 20 minutes away. Transportation options include taxis, limousines, rental car and a shuttle service to the downtown core.
Parking
Indoor valet parking is available. Cars are left with our valet at the hotel’s front entrance. Daily parking fees are applicable. Hand car wash service available. Additional parking and self-park options are available adjacent to the hotel.

Meetings and Banquets
Loews Hotel Vogue offers 12 function rooms accommodating from 8 to 350 people, for a total capacity of 6,517 square feet. Among these are 3 permanently dedicated Executive Boardrooms. Computer, fax, telephone ports and wireless Internet are available in all salons.

Premium Double
This 400-square-foot room features two double beds with down comforters and Sleep Number® by Select Comfort mattresses. The bathroom has its own flat-screen TV and phone, a jetted, deep-soaking bathtub with separate shower, and amenities including bathrobes, a hair dryer, makeup/shaving mirror, bathroom scale, and complimentary toiletries. Renovated in 2012, the room offers amenities including air conditioning and climate control, as well as a 32-inch flat-panel television with cable channels and pay movies, a work desk, speakerphone, iPod docking station, laptop-compatible safe, CD player, and clock radio. Wired and wireless Internet access is available for a surcharge. In-room massages, guest voice mail and wake-up call service is available, and all guestrooms include a minibar, coffee/tea maker and complimentary daily newspapers. The suite is non-smoking.
